**Quarterly Planning Note — Ferrandale Holdings**

For the board: the Q3 cash-flow forecast shows a modest surplus, driven by earlier-than-expected receipts from the Wexbrook contract. Operating outflows remain within plan; capital spend on the Milthorpe facility is deferred to Q4. Working capital coverage stands at 2.1 months. No covenant concerns are anticipated. The associated planning note appears below.

internal memo for kawip-hadug: Headcount on the Wenwyn team goes from 7 to 140 by the end of January. Gross margin on Wenwyn came in at 20 percent against a plan of 15 percent.

## Authentication

Heads up: the nightly reindex job (`reindex_nightly.py`) talks to the Lanternfish search cluster, and that cluster won't accept anonymous writes anymore — we locked it down last sprint. The job now authenticates as the `reindex-runner` service identity against Corvid Gateway, and the token is injected via the `LF_INDEX_TOKEN` env var in the scheduler config. Nothing clever going on, just a bearer header on every batch request. For review purposes, the staging credential currently in use is listed below.

service key, kadug-kadup: kto15_rN23XLAYImmZgrJ

Attendees: H. Delacroix (Chair), M. Ostrander, F. Quill.

The board approved replacing the current Pinpoints scheme with a tiered model branded Harborcard. Key changes: points expire after eighteen months, silver tier unlocks at 500 points, and in-branch redemption becomes instant. Pilot branches in the Netherby district convert first; remaining branches follow within ninety days. Branch managers must complete staff training before go-live. Migration messaging is being drafted. The commercial reasoning is set out in the note below.

internal memo for yahif-fahip: Headcount on the Ralix team goes from 7 to 120 by the end of January. Gross margin on Ralix came in at 10 percent against a plan of 15 percent.